Alex Pereira Player Overview
The Brazilian fighter, known for his kickboxing skills, began his sports career in this combat sport. After a successful performance at the professional level, he transitioned to MMA, where he caught the attention of the UFC after just four fights. Following two convincing victories in the world's largest organization, he established himself as a serious contender for top positions. To test his level, he was offered a fight against Sean Strickland, who at that time was his sparring partner. Pereira easily handled this challenge, knocking Strickland out in the first round. His bouts with Israel Adesanya attracted special attention, as Pereira had a long-standing rivalry with him dating back to their kickboxing days. After losing the middleweight title, the Brazilian decided to move up to light heavyweight, where he continued to deliver impressive results. Over the course of a year, he secured victories over fighters such as Jan Blachowicz, Jamahal Hill, and Jiri Prochazka, solidifying his status as champion. Last October, "Poatan" defended his belt for the third time, defeating Khalil Rountree. Currently, Alex has 12 wins and 2 losses on his record.

Magomed Ankalaev Player Overview
The Russian athlete is a versatile fighter, holding the title of Master of Sports in Sambo and International Master of Sports in MMA. He began his professional career in 2014. After achieving success in the WFCA organization, where he became a champion, Ankalaev secured a contract with the UFC. His debut in the UFC was unsuccessful: Magomed suffered his only career defeat, losing to Paul Craig at the end of the fight. However, since then, the Russian has remained undefeated, confidently defeating his opponents, often by knockouts. Among his opponents are well-known fighters such as Johnny Walker, Anthony Smith, and Thiago Santos. The latest opponent he defeated was Aleksandar Rakic, whom Magomed beat at UFC 308. Currently, the Russian ranks first in the UFC rankings in his division. His professional record is 20 wins, one loss, and one draw.
